Gadget repair
How to diagnose failing SSDs and perform secure cloning before replacing them to prevent data loss during upgrades.
This evergreen guide explains practical methods for identifying failing solid state drives, prioritizing safe cloning, and executing reliable upgrades while preserving data integrity and system continuity.
Published by
Scott Morgan
August 03, 2025 - 3 min Read
SSD health diagnostic steps begin with evaluating SMART attributes and running manufacturer tools to establish baseline performance indicators. Start by connecting the drive to a stable test bench, ensuring power is reliable and cables are well-seated. Examine metrics such as read and write error rates, reallocated sectors, wear level, and temperature. When values drift beyond safe thresholds, consider limiting intensive operations to reduce further wear. Gather data from multiple runs to confirm a pattern rather than a one-off spike. If the drive shows intermittent failures, document the symptoms with timestamps and any corresponding system events. These records help you decide between repair, cloning, or immediate replacement.
After identifying a suspect SSD, plan a secure cloning workflow before any replacement. Choose a cloning method that preserves boot sectors, partition maps, and hidden recovery partitions. Prefer sector-by-sector cloning for exact copies on drives with mixed file systems, but consider file-level cloning if the source shows large, contiguous blocks of unreadable sectors. Before starting, disable fast startup and hibernation to avoid lockups and ensure all data is consistent. Disconnect peripheral drives to prevent accidental overwrites, and verify the destination’s health status with a quick SMART pass. Finally, label the target drive clearly and maintain a meticulous record of clone times, source, and destination.
Build a robust cloning plan with safeguards and validation steps.
Begin by verifying the drive’s firmware is up to date, as outdated firmware can cause stability problems that mimic hardware failures. Update only if the system is powered on a stable line and the process is unlikely to interrupt critical operations. Create a campus of recovery points by enabling a temporary backup window where the clone can complete without interference. Use a reliable cloning tool that supports both MBR and GPT layouts, ensuring the boot loader is preserved. If encryption is used, manage keys securely and verify post-clone integrity with a fresh decryption test. Don’t proceed with replacement until you confirm a successful, verifiable clone.
After the initial clone completes, perform a thorough integrity check on the destination drive. Run a read-through test to verify data blocks match the source, and check file hashes for critical folders. Boot the system from the cloned drive in a non-production environment to observe behavior without risking data loss on the main device. If the clone passes all checks, simulate a normal shutdown and restart sequence to catch any boot-time issues. Document any anomalies and compare them against known-good baselines to ensure consistency.
Validate the clone’s reliability through practical, scenario-based testing.
When preparing to clone, decide on a toolchain that aligns with your operating system and hardware. Prefer utilities that can handle large sectors efficiently and provide log files for auditing purposes. Create a controlled environment free from external network influences to prevent unexpected interruptions. Ensure write caching is disabled on both source and destination to avoid hidden data discrepancies. Keep a precise clock synchronized using network time protocol, which helps correlate events across devices during troubleshooting. Craft a step-by-step runbook with explicit success criteria and rollback options should the clone fail at any point.
After cloning, verify the clone’s reliability with practical tests that simulate everyday usage. Open essential applications, run system updates, and launch a handful of important services to gauge response times. Perform file integrity checks on critical directories and confirm that scheduled tasks and permissions remain intact. If any mismatch appears, re-scan the source for corrupted data blocks and re-clone the affected areas. Maintain an auditable trail of checks, timestamps, and outcomes. Only then should you proceed to physically replace the faulty drive in a controlled downtime window.
Implement post-clone checks and early-warning monitoring systems.
In the final stages, prepare the replacement SSD by ensuring it is compatible with your motherboard and supports the correct interface and NVMe protocol if applicable. Format the drive according to your partitioning scheme, and restore any necessary recovery partitions. Test the system’s boot sequence from the new drive to confirm that the clone’s MBR or GPT data aligns with firmware expectations. If problems arise, consult the clone log for clues such as mismatched sector counts or corrupted boot records. Maintain a cautious approach, especially in production environments where downtime has real costs.
Once the new drive is installed, perform post-installation health checks to confirm long-term reliability. Run extended self-tests that stress read/write operations under nominal temperatures. Monitor SMART data for accelerated wear indicators or abnormal error rates, which can signal latent issues. Confirm that performance metrics—throughput, latency, and queue depth—meet expected baselines. Enable regular health reporting to detect drift over time. Schedule periodic verifications after major software updates or configuration changes to catch problems early and prevent data loss during future upgrades.
Summarize actionable steps and lasting best practices for safe upgrades.
Beyond immediate hardware concerns, consider a proactive backup strategy to mitigate future risks. Regularly scheduled backups with versioning can protect against both hardware failure and user error. Test restoration procedures to guarantee that entire systems or individual files can be recovered quickly. Do quarterly drills to validate the end-to-end process, including the ability to boot from backup media if the primary drive fails. Use immutable storage for critical data when possible to prevent accidental or malicious tampering. Document recovery objectives, restore time targets, and responsible team members for rapid escalation.
When upgrading storage, ensure your software stack is prepared for the larger capacity and potential performance changes. Update drivers and firmware for both host controllers and SSDs, and verify kernel or OS patches that improve disk handling. Revisit power management settings to avoid aggressive sleep states that might interrupt long clone tasks. Establish a maintenance window with clear communication to users about expected downtime. After installation, run a final round of health checks and validate that all partitions mount correctly and that system services are stable and responsive under load.
The essence of safe SSD upgrading lies in careful diagnosis, deliberate cloning, and disciplined validation. Start by collecting baseline health data, then proceed to a secure clone that preserves boot information and configuration. Validate the clone with hands-on testing and systematic checks before replacing the original drive. Keep thorough records of all steps, settings, and outcomes to facilitate future troubleshooting. Maintain a clear rollback plan, and never skip a post-clone health assessment, as hidden sectors or boot issues can silently undermine upgrades. These habits protect data integrity while minimizing downtime in real-world environments.
Finally, cultivate a routine that binds preventive maintenance to upgrade cycles. Schedule periodic health audits, maintain current backups, and rehearse disaster recovery procedures so you can act decisively when symptoms reappear. By adopting a structured approach to diagnosing SSD health and executing secure cloning, you extend device longevity and safeguard critical information. Treat every upgrade as a controlled operation, with verifiable tests, documented results, and a clear path to restoration if anything deviates from plan. Continuous learning and disciplined execution are your strongest allies in data-centric workflows.